Bioart, which merges biological sciences with artistic expression, often sparks intense ethical debates because it challenges traditional boundaries and raises questions about morality, safety, and responsibility. When you explore this domain, you’ll encounter provocative works that utilize genetic modification to alter living organisms or employ animal experimentation to create striking visuals or concepts. These techniques push the limits of conventional science and art, prompting you to consider whether the ends justify the means.
Genetic modification in bioart involves editing the DNA of organisms to produce extraordinary visual effects or to explore new aesthetic territories. You might see artists who manipulate genes to create glowing plants or animals with unusual features, blurring the line between natural and artificial. While these innovations can inspire awe and challenge your perceptions of life, they also raise concerns about unintended consequences. For instance, altering an organism’s genetic makeup could have unpredictable effects on ecosystems or human health if such modifications were to escape controlled environments. The debate intensifies as you weigh the creative potential against the ethical implications of playing god with life itself.
Genetic editing in bioart sparks awe and ethical concerns over unintended consequences and playing god with life.
Animal experimentation remains another contentious issue in bioart. Artists often utilize animals to demonstrate biological processes or evoke emotional responses, sometimes involving invasive procedures or living displays. You may find yourself questioning whether subjecting animals to experimental art is justifiable, especially when the animals endure discomfort or harm. Critics argue that such practices violate animal rights and reduce sentient beings to mere tools for artistic exploration. Conversely, some defend these works as necessary to challenge societal norms, raise awareness, or provoke critical dialogue about human-animal relationships. As you reflect on these practices, you’re compelled to consider where your own boundaries lie regarding the use of animals in the pursuit of artistic or scientific advancement.
